1 definition by someone12313453142145315

someone that you want to make out with
girl 1: There's Harry

girl 2: I'll be back in a sec......

(few moments later)
girl 2: i'm back
girl 1: What happened?
girl 2: Oh he was great.
by someone12313453142145315 March 30, 2011
